Output 3acf60cb65a50c8d46f9668e2aa4d065d6b385ed584ea765e75cade461c153c1:4

value
7568037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c245a9b3af9660636645db56d0677f0daae095b OP_EQUAL
address
3EU25KFMkW9yVErachV1Kragz6E6KzkWy1
transaction
3acf60cb65a50c8d46f9668e2aa4d065d6b385ed584ea765e75cade461c153c1
spent
true